I think vdip has a concede option, where you vote for defeat.
drano019 (1003 D)
05 Feb 13 UTC
vdip does have a concede option, however, it only does something if everyone but one person votes concede. In a classic game, if there's 5 concede votes and 2 non-votes, nothing happens. Once the 6th vote comes in, the last person (who has not voted concede), gets an automatic victory and everyone else gets a defeat.

So while it does offer a way to end a game early (assuming everyone agrees the game is lost), it does not provide a way for people to "quit" early (which is how it should be. Finish your damn games you signed up for!).
Droidippy has a similar concede feature wherein if all remaining players except one concede, the one who is still playing to win gets the victory. Likewise if 2 or more players agree to a draw amongst themselves and the remaining players concede, the draw is given without having to actually eliminate the conceding players.
